Bias education for tutors: Establishing a safe, supporting environment on June 12, 2020 12:00 PM EDT
Our Presenter: Abe Saunders, College of Charleston, SC
Summary: Incidents of bias happen every day; consequently, our learning centers are not immune to the effects of microaggressions and implicit bias. To what extent is your organization proactive in identifying, safeguarding against, and responding to incidents
of bias?
The purpose of this session is to discuss best practices for conceptualizing and including bias education into your tutor (or Supplemental Instructor, peer academic coaching, etc.) training programs so that your tutors may feel equipped, supported, and
empowered to effectively identify – and when appropriate – manage these challenging scenarios.
Participants can expect to take-away the following from this webinar:
- Be able to identify examples of how bias may occur in tutoring relationships
- A collection of recommended “Training Do’s” to include in your bias education training
- Explore techniques that tutors may use to respond to bias incidents

Academic Coaching: How to move your successful program to the online environment June 26, 2020 12:00 PM EDT
Our Presenters: Kiara Kumar (UCF), Becky Piety (UCF), and Tasha Ziegler (FGCU)
Join us as we discuss how to move your academic coaching program to an effective process online. Peer academic coaching and professional academic success coaching are programs provided within the learning centers at the University of Central Florida and
Florida Gulf Coast University. This webinar presents the detailed transition to a fully online program during the spring 2020 term. Participants will learn about each department, what resources were utilized, testimonials from staff about their experiences,
and lessons learned by staff at each institution.
Learning Objectives
Attendees will be able to…
1. Understand the different demands between transitioning a peer coaching program and a professional coaching program online
2. Identify the resources needed to move a coaching program online
3. Discuss how transitioning an academic coaching program can be highly effective in an online environment
4. Consider staff members’ experiences as they facilitate academic coaching online
